Mumbai Police to deploy 40,000 cops on election duty; issue guidelines

204 additional personnel have been deployed out of city limits to ensure hassle-free polling in Mumbai on 29 April; measures taken to boost security for the 2019 Lok Sabha elections in wake of the recent blasts in Sri Lanka

The Mumbai police are ensuring that polling is fare and without any hassles whatsoever when Mumbaikars go out to vote on April 29 for the 2019 Lok Sabha elections. The police department has put in place a report on the preparedness for the Lok Sabha elections in Mumbai for the six parliamentary constituencies-Mumbai North, Mumbai North-West, Mumbai North-East, Mumbai North-Central, Mumbai South-Central and Mumbai South.

In lieu of the elections in Mumbai on April 29, the Mumbai police will be deploying close to 40000 personnel on election duty. They have 204 persons out of city limits as well so that there are no problems during polling.
